Comprehending Landscaping Services: Key Details You Should Understand

Even though countless homeowners appreciate the aesthetic appeal of a carefully maintained yard, they may not entirely comprehend the range of landscaping services provided. Landscaping covers a multitude of tasks, from design and installation to maintenance and renovation. This can include tasks such as planting trees, shrubs, and flowers, creating garden beds, and putting down sod or artificial turf. Moreover, hardscaping elements like patios, walkways, and retaining walls also belong to this category, boosting outdoor usability and visual appeal.

Effective landscaping relies on irrigation systems and drainage solutions as essential components, ensuring that plants receive adequate water while preventing flooding. Year-round seasonal maintenance services like lawn mowing, pruning, and mulching maintain outdoor spaces in pristine condition. Comprehending these varied services enables homeowners to make knowledgeable choices, customizing their landscaping projects to satisfy their specific requirements and tastes while maximizing the beauty and value of their properties.

Assessing Your Space

To establish a dream garden, one must first evaluate the available space thoroughly. This evaluation involves gauging the area, considering sunlight exposure, and identifying existing features such as trees, slopes, and soil quality. Understanding the microclimates within the space is vital, as different sections may receive diverse amounts of light and moisture. Furthermore, assessing the surrounding environment, including surrounding properties and local wildlife, can influence design choices. Accessibility should also be taken into account, ensuring pathways and seating areas are functional and inviting. By taking these factors into account, one can establish a solid foundation for designing a garden that integrates with its surroundings while meeting personal aesthetic and functional expectations.

Picking the Right Plants for Your Climate and Soil

Comprehending the distinct properties of a given climate and soil type is crucial for successful landscaping, as these factors significantly impact plant health and growth. Each region has its own climate characteristics, including temperature differences, rainfall patterns, and sunlight exposure, which establish which plants grow well. Additionally, soil composition—such as pH level, drainage, and nutrient content—affects root development and overall plant vitality.

To select the right plants, one must investigate local flora that is suited to the climate and soil. Native plants are typically a dependable choice, needing less water and maintenance. Moreover, seeking advice from local horticulturists or landscape professionals can deliver valuable insights into ideal plant selections. By aligning plant choices with environmental conditions, individuals can create a sustainable and vibrant landscape that flourishes throughout the seasons, ultimately improving the beauty and functionality of outdoor spaces.

Exterior Lighting Alternatives

Numerous landscape lighting solutions can change outdoor spaces into breathtaking environments, emphasizing features and creating focal points that improve the overall aesthetic. Pathway lights deliver safety and elegance, directing visitors through gardens and yards. Uplighting can enhance trees, sculptures, or architectural elements, creating dramatic shadows and depth. Spotlights focus attention on specific features, while downlights replicate moonlight, providing a serene ambiance. String lights add a whimsical touch, perfect for patios or outdoor dining areas. Solar lights present an eco-friendly solution, requiring no wiring and offering flexibility in placement. By blending different lighting methods, homeowners can craft an inviting atmosphere that displays their landscape's beauty and functionality, making it pleasant both day and night.

Benefits of Water Features

Integrating water features within a landscape design can significantly enhance the overall appeal and ambiance of outdoor spaces. These components, such as fountains, ponds, and waterfalls, not only serve as stunning focal points but also create a tranquil atmosphere. The sound of flowing water can cover unwanted noise, fostering relaxation and enhancing the outdoor experience. Additionally, water features attract wildlife, including birds and beneficial insects, fostering a thriving ecosystem. They can also enhance air quality and humidity levels, making the environment more pleasant. Moreover, water features can increase property value, drawing potential buyers seeking a serene retreat. Overall, thoughtfully placed water features can transform an ordinary landscape into an extraordinary sanctuary.

Seasonal Landscaping Tips for Success

In what ways can homeowners effectively modify their landscaping strategies throughout the year? Seasonal changes necessitate particular approaches to maintain superior outdoor aesthetics and health. In spring, homeowners should concentrate on planting flowers, pruning trees, and applying fertilizer to promote growth. This is also an perfect time for overseeding lawns and preparing garden beds.

The summer season demands consistent watering and mulching to preserve moisture and prevent weeds. Frequent mowing is important to maintain lawn health and appearance.

With the arrival of autumn, homeowners should consider planting perennials, removing debris, and raking leaves to ensure winter readiness. This is also an ideal time to nourish the lawn and garden for winter resilience.

Throughout the winter months, protection becomes essential. Home gardeners should shield vulnerable plants, look for frost damage, and schedule their outdoor projects for the upcoming year, ensuring a successful transition into spring.

Can I Choose Eco-Friendly Landscaping Solutions?

Green landscaping alternatives are certainly available. Available choices feature area-native flora, low-water landscaping, chemical-free gardening techniques, bio-retention gardens, and organic waste recycling. These approaches encourage sustainability, reduce consumption of water, and support regional environments while enriching the beauty of outdoor spaces.

How Can I Prepare My Yard for Winter?

To ready a yard for winter, one should eliminate debris, till the soil, add mulch, protect delicate plants with covers, and ensure proper drainage to prevent water accumulation, thereby protecting the landscape for spring growth.

What Permits Are Required for Landscaping Projects?

For landscaping projects, one may require permits for removing trees, major grading, or constructing structures. Local regulations vary, so consulting the city or zoning office is necessary to verify compliance with all required permits.
